I was down at the DMV and I was getting in my car and I was approached by a man driving a brand new f150 (had dealer plates on it) he looked like he was about in his 60's. Anyways he gave me some very nice compliments on the stang he also told me he was looking for one. I told him they should not be hard to find at the dealers anymore and he said that they are not making them (05's) and he was just went to a few dealers already. He said that the car looked like the 69 mustang he had when he was younger. He asked to look at the engine and the interior of the car so of course when I popped the hood the first thing he asked about was the CIA intake he asked whoa what the he11 is that thing? i gave him the info and all about it and the tuner he was captivated and he looked over the leather interior and asked if I would be willing to sell my car? WHAT WHAT!! I have about 4,000 miles I asked him how much, and that I would sell it for no less that 30 grand. He gave me his phone number I also told him I would think about it. I am really considering and if I do it I will definately put in an order for a Shelby. A local dealers waiting list is at 5 people. Has anyone else been asked about selling the 05?
